Channel 1
Home Tags James Muraguri

Tag: James Muraguri

The Executive Board: What does greylisting Kenya by a global financial...

Kenya was greylisted by a global financial taskforce on 23rd Feb 2023, the same time Uganda was let off the hook, what does this mean for our country? The CEO of Institute of Public Finance, James Muraguri terms the economy as sluggish amidst this latest development.


Skip to content